External vs internal gears

An external gear is one with the teeth formed on the outer surface of a cylinder or cone. Conversely, an internal gear is one with the teeth formed on the inner surface of a cylinder or cone. For bevel gears , an internal gear is one with the pitch angle exceeding 90 degrees. Internal gears do not cause output shaft direction reversal

Most of the offsets used in piping runs are made with 45,60, 11 and 1/4 degrees  respectively  T = S x  table value T= travel  S= set, table  value( for 45 degree =1.414. for 60 degree =1.155 and for 11 and 1/4 =5.125)

PHYSICS OF SEAM BOWLING

Seam bowling   is a phrase used for a   bowling   technique in   cricket   whereby the ball is deliberately bowled on to its seam, to cause a random deviation. Practitioners are known as   seam   bowlers   or   seamers . Seam bowling is generally classed as a subtype of   fast bowling , although the bowling speeds at which seam can be a factor include medium-pace bowling. Although there are specialist seamers that make deliberate use of   Off cutter   and   Leg cutter   at the expense of bowling slower than regular fast bowlers, most bowlers employ the seam to some effect and so the terms "seamer" and "fast bowler" are largely synonymous. A   cricket ball   is not a perfect   sphere . The seam of the ball is the circular stitching which joins the two halves of the cricket ball. Scope and Limitations of Utilisation of Non-edible Vegetable Oils as a Substitute Fuel for Diesel Engines

For India, there is a need to take a mission approach to explore the possibility of using straight  unmodified vegetable oils/ their blends with mineral diesel as alternative fuel in order to reduce the pollution and to increase the energy security of the country, especially in rural areas. This aimed at exploring technical feasibility of using straight vegetable oils (Jatropha and Karanja) in direct injection compression ignition engine without major hardware modifications. Since use of unprocessed straight vegetable oils has its own merits, it was decided to examine two most commonly available oils (in unmodified form) in an unmodified constant-speed direct-injection diesel engine typically used in the agricultural sector in India. Study was carried out in two phases for (i) Straight vegetable oils and their higher blend, and (ii) lower blends of vegetable oils. Various Types Of CRANES

Image
A crane is a tower or derrick that is equipped with cables and pulleys that are used to lift and lower material. They are commonly used in the construction industry and in the manufacturing of heavy equipment. Cranes for construction are normally temporary structures  either fixed to the ground or mounted on a purpose built vehicle.They can either be controlled from an operator in a cab that travels along with the crane, by a push button pendant control station, or by radio type controls. The crane operator is ultimately responsible for the safety of the crews and the crane. Mobile Cranes The most basic type of crane consists of a steel truss or telescopic boom mounted on a mobile platform, which could be a rail, wheeled, or even on a cat truck. Nomogram.an Aalignment chart

Image
A  nomogram , also called a  nomograph ,  alignment chart  or  abaque , is a graphical calculating device, a two-dimensional diagram designed to allow the approximate graphical computation of a function. The field of nomography was invented in 1884 by the French engineer Philbert Maurice d’Ocagne (1862-1938) and used extensively for many years to provide engineers with fast graphical calculations of complicated formulas to a practical precision. Nomograms use a parallel  coordinate system  invented by d'Ocagne rather than standard  Cartesian coordinates . A nomogram consists of a set of n scales, one for each variable in an equation. Knowing the values of n-1 variables, the value of the unknown variable can be found, or by fixing the values of some variables, the relationship between the unfixed ones can be studied.
